Scandinavian Airlines introduces new in-flight connectivity with the addition of free, high-speed WiFi in partnership with Starlink, a company engineered by SpaceX. Starlink is the world’s first and largest satellite constellation using a low Earth orbit, and the brand will provide SAS passengers in all flight classes with high-speed, low-latency internet for free. The airline will begin to roll out this service in phases, with the entire fleet implementing serice by the end of 2025.

“By introducing this new technology, we’re connecting our passengers to the world like never before,” said Paul Verhagen, CCO, SAS. “We’re putting an end to frustrating interruptions and ushering in a new era of connectivity. Whether flying over the Atlantic or the North Sea, our passengers can now count on a connection that is as stable and seamless as it is fast. This is about giving our customers the best and ensuring SAS remains synonymous with excellence.”
Passengers flying on SAS will be able to enjoy WiFi connectivity as soon as they board, with service lasting until they disembark. This is a significant improvement from the current system that kicks in after take-off and shuts off during descent.
The new service will support multiple devices at once to allow passengers to stay productive and entertained across smartphones, tablets and laptops without having to compromise.
